When it comes to social media marketing the right way, it's all about the titles. It doesn't matter where you're leaving a post, you should focus on the right type of title. With headlines and titles that stand out, they can be powerful tools which draw in people and make them want to know who you are and eventually will lead them to your site.





Take the time to respond to the feedback from your customers. If you are interested in building a successful business, your customers have valuable information to share. The problem most companies have is that they are all ears and no response. When customers know you are responding to their needs via their feedback, they will want to continue doing business.





Add a Facebook "like box" where visitors can easily see and click it. This box lets people LIKE you on Facebook. People can do this without navigating away from the page. This means that they never have to leave. It's something really simple but incredibly convenient that can help you increase your network a lot.

Use social media marketing to direct people to your website. Social media is limited compared to what a website can offer. For instance, you cannot directly sell a product from your page on social media, but you can from a website. Doing this can lead to a direct sale by using social media marketing.





Your website should include relevant social networking widgets. The ideal way to glean followers is by placing widgets onto your site. A widget on your site lets your readers re-tweet your content and vote on it's quality. You won't need to rely on anonymous reviews on non-connected websites.

Make use of Twitter related tools, like Twellow. These tools allow you to find users who belong to your target audience and identify the most influential users. This can enable you go come up with people that it would be wise for you to follow, and will increase the chances that these people will follow you as well.





Tailor your posts to your target audience's experiences. You should write about things your customers can relate to or they will not share your content with their friends. Take the time to read the status updates your customers are posting and identify recurring themes and issues you could mention in your own posts.
